Hoi An is a small riverside town on Vietnam's central coast, known for its preserved trading port architecture and centuries of cultural exchange between Vietnamese, Chinese, Japanese, and European.Hoi An is a small riverside town on Vietnam's central coast, known for its preserved trading port architecture and centuries of cultural exchange between Vietnamese, Chinese, Japanese, and European merchants. This guide introduces you to the town's history, its historic buildings and temples, and the customs that shape daily life there today. You will find practical information on getting to Hoi An, moving around its old quarter, and planning visits to nearby beaches and countryside. The book also covers local food, craft traditions such as tailoring and lantern making, and the seasonal festivals that mark the town's calendar.
